UAE’s exit from OPEC seen as move to diversify foreign policy and boost economic autonomy

The United Arab Emirates announced its departure from the OPEC oil cartel, framing the decision as part of a strategy to strengthen economic independence. Analysts view the exit as a sign that the Gulf state will pursue higher‑risk geopolitical actions to expand its global influence. The move coincided with a downgrade in the country’s credit rating, adding to the strategic calculations.
